Summary
This bill directs the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) to: track VA provider workloads considering the time, mental effort and judgment, technical skill, physical effort, and stress involved in delivering a procedure; require VA providers to attend training on clinical procedure coding; and establish standardized performance standards for each VA facility in order to evaluate clinical productivity at the provider and facility levels.
